Job description

We are hiring a seasoned VP-Level Major Incident Manager to lead end-to-end management of high-severity technology incidents across a complex, regulated environment. You will command incidents from detection through restoration, ensure crisp executive communications, drive cross-technology recovery, and influence decisions that directly impact operational stability. What you'll do: • Lead and coordinate major incidents across infrastructure, applications, middleware, cloud, EUC, network, identity, data, and third parties • Establish and manage incident command structure, including team roles, bridge calls, and communications, ensuring clear ownership and rapid triage • Drive restoration by coordinating technical SMEs, vendors, and operations teams; remove blockers and manage dependencies • Maintain operational discipline by tracking timelines, actions, risks, and decisions; provide real-time updates to senior management • Manage senior stakeholders across Technology and Business: set expectations, manage impact narratives, and escalate decisively • Perform risk and impact analyses, rapidly assessing the wider implications of outages (business, regulatory, reputational, and security impact) and drive timely escalation and mitigation decisions • Execute Change and Problem Management responsibilities as needed, including post-incident stakeholder management and risk assessment • Perform concise handovers of live incidents to ensure seamless transitions within the follow-the-sun operational model What you'll bring: • 3+ years leading major incidents in a large-scale, 24/7 production environment within financial services • Proven ability to act as incident commander under pressure with strong operational judgment • Strong understanding of modern technology stacks (distributed systems, cloud, networks, identity, databases, messaging) • Exceptional logical and problem-solving skills, particularly for unfamiliar technology systems • Solid grasp of cybersecurity concepts and operational risk, including the ability to pivot incident response for potential security impact • Experienced in ITIL-aligned practices (Incident, Problem, Change) in enterprise environments • Outstanding written and verbal communication skills; able to translate technical detail into business risk and action • Strong stakeholder management and influencing skills; able to challenge senior technology leadership respectfully • Excellent organ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ple concurrent tasks • Knowledge of enterprise infrastructure including: • Operating Systems (Unix, Windows, Mainframe) • Storage (NFS, SAN, NAS) • Databases (DB2, Sybase, GreenPlum) • Web Infrastructure (Load Balancers, Web Proxies) • Data Centers (Cooling, Power, Infrastructure) • Networks (Switch, Router, DNS, DHCP, Firewalls) • Virtualization (Hypervisors) • Authentication (Kerberos, PKI, SiteMinder, LDAP, Active Directory) • Cloud Platforms (SaaS, IaaS, PaaS - Azure, AWS) Robert Walters Operations Limited is an employment business and employment agency and welcomes applications from all candidates
